Epic fantasy flop John Carter is going to cost Disney big bucks: on Monday, the studio released a statement projecting a total loss of $200 million.

So far, the film about a former military captain who is transported to Mars, has generated $184 million in ticket sales worldwide. That is far shy from the audience needed to earn back the movie's estimated $250 million production budget, plus tens of millions more that Disney spent on advertising.

In response to the news, Disney shares immediately dropped 1 percent in after-hours trading. While the Mouse can surely take the hit, this is still a staggering flop — not to mention a delight for fans of schadenfreude.
